Kanji | 聡 |
---|---|
Onyomi | ソウ |
Kunyomi | さと.い, みみざと.い |
Nanori | さと, さとし, さとる, あき, あきら, とし, さた, みのる |
English | wise, fast learner |
JLPT Level | 1 |
Jouyou Grade | S+ |
Frequency | 1507 |
Components | 耳: ear 公: public; prince; official; governmental 心: heart; mind; spirit; heart radical (no. 61) |
Traditional Form | (none) |
Keyword | attentive |
Koohii Story 1 | Policymakers' ears have to be attentive to the heart of the public. |
Koohii Story 2 | "If you open your ears (耳をすませば), you can be attentive to the public's heart. -------------- OR -------------- It only takes one ear that is attentive to the public heart to win them over." |
